The latest Valentine brain break is here! If you're looking for games for kids or fun classroom activities, then you don't want to miss out on Valentine's Day Emoji Pictionary! In this GoNoodle inspired activity, players will study the emoji clue and then try to solve the clue by performing the activity that matches with the correct word or phrase. Not only is it a fun fitness workout, but it's also a good brain game / challenge as well! Try to beat all 3 levels!
